TV specifications: Size, resolution, and HDR compatibility
When it comes to TV specifications, there are a few key things to consider. First, think about the size of the TV and how it will fit in your space. Measure the area where you plan to place the TV and choose a size that works well for your viewing distance.
Next, consider the resolution. 4K TVs have become the norm these days, offering incredibly sharp and detailed images. However, if you're on a tight budget, a 1080p TV can still provide a great viewing experience.
Lastly, HDR (High Dynamic Range) compatibility is worth considering. HDR enhances the contrast and color range of the TV, resulting in more vibrant and lifelike images. Look for TVs that support HDR10 or Dolby Vision for the best picture quality.

How should I adjust my TV's picture settings?
The optimal picture settings can vary depending on personal preference, but a good starting point is to choose the "Movie" or "Cinema" picture mode. From there, you can make minor adjustments to the brightness, contrast, and color settings to suit your taste.
How long do TVs typically last?
On average, TVs have a lifespan of around 7-10 years. Of course, this can vary depending on usage and care. It's always a good idea to invest in a TV with a solid warranty to protect your investment.
Can I use a TV as a computer monitor?
Absolutely! Many modern TVs have a dedicated PC mode that optimizes the display for use with a computer. Just make sure the TV has the necessary connections (like HDMI or DisplayPort) and adjust the settings accordingly.
What happened to 3D TVs?
3D TVs had their moment in the spotlight but have since fallen out of favor with consumers. The technology never quite caught on, and most manufacturers have shifted their focus to other features like HDR and smart TV capabilities.
